I have been exchanging e-mails with departments at city hall and it is starting to become clear that as the old saying goes, people do not like change.

I reported some trash at locations, one of which is on Airport Highway. This location had loose corrugated card board on and near the curb line.

I made reference to a Tarta bus stop as a landmark and did not state the trash was at the bus stop but merely the bus stop.

So, Solid Waste forwards it to the Neighborhoods Department and then I get an e-mail from Manager Frederick advising me that I am not to report non solid waste issues to Solid Waste, which I did not.

I reported trash near a bus stop and used the bus stop as a land mark and reported it to Solid Waste. The manager of sold waste advised in e-mail that her department is responsible for trash near the curb line and right of ways.

And so the circus music is cued again and the merry-go-round spins.

And I get a request from the Neighborhoods Department manager for a sit down meeting to which I declined for the same reason as I declined the offer of a sit down meeting with Solid Waste.

Just do the job you were appointed too and I will continue to report, as a citizen, problems I see wrong.
